Instead of being turned into affordable housing, the Freehold Mall is about to get a really big makeover with a major store set to move in.

Alex Reizner, managing partner of Aspen Real Estate told David P. Willis, the man on the pulse of "What's Going There" with the Asbury Park Press that within a year the mall will have a new facade, new roof, and plenty of new tenants. Reizner also added that the parking lot will get a much-needed upgrade with new lines and lighting.

Food chain Aldi will continue its expansion in Monmouth County with a new store slated for Freehold Mall.

According to APP,  about 70% of Freehold Mall is currently leased. Current tenants include Burlington, Freehold Music Store, Route 9 Farmers Market, and Firestone Complete Auto Care. All of these businesses are expected to remain. This upgrade is probably a long time coming for them. They deserve it for hanging on to a location that has had its issues over the years.

AutoZone has made an agreement to open a location at Freehold Mall. Look for the auto retailer to set up next to Terrace Bagels.
